Senior apartments offer a no-frills housing option for active and independent seniors. Units are often designed with senior-friendly features for accessibility, such as elevators and wide doorways. Senior living community price is affected by the community where it is located. The rent burden for Tarrytown is around 23.0% of the average monthly income. Tarrytown has a median home value of $581,576 and the median cost of rent is around $2,708 per month.
Demographically, Tarrytown is 0.0% Pacific Islander or Native Hawaiian, 5.4% black, 6.4% Asian, 1.2% mixed race, 28.4% Hispanic, 76.2% white, 10.8% other or not specified, and 0.0% Native American. In Tarrytown, 4.1% of the people are veterans. Out of the total city population, 51.7% are female and 48.3% are male. The median age of Tarrytown is 40 years old. Tarrytown has a population density of 1,526 people per square mile. Currently, the population of Tarrytown consists of 11,572 people. In Tarrytown, 4.8% do not have health insurance, 70.0% participate in the labor force, 8.2% have some form of disability, and 2.8% live in poverty. Of the population of Tarrytown 54.7% have a college degree, 28.9% have a graduate degree, and 14.8% have a high-school diploma.
